About the Role

Imagine helping patients receive high-quality care without leaving their homes. At DrHouse, we are building a new model of virtual healthcare that is fast, accessible, and centered on both patient and provider experience.

DrHouse is seeking board-certified OB/GYN physicians to join our growing telemedicine team. This is a telehealth position open to physicians licensed in California (CA). Providers may reside anywhere in California, including major metropolitan areas such as Los Angeles, San Diego, San Jose, San Francisco, and Fresno, as well as rural and underserved communities throughout California.

This role offers the flexibility to design a schedule that supports work-life balance while delivering high-quality, patient-centered virtual care statewide.

We are looking for physicians who bring both clinical excellence and compassion to an innovative telemedicine platform. In this role, you will manage a broad spectrum of clinical cases, including primary care, urgent care, men’s and women’s health, and chronic conditions, all delivered through secure virtual consultations.

What You’ll Be Doing

  • Conduct video-based appointments for non-emergency issues.
  • Treat patients in internal medicine and related areas such as urgent care, gynecology, and obesity care.
  • Design personalized treatment plans supported by current clinical guidelines.
  • Record encounters using our efficient EHR tools for accurate follow-up and prescriptions.
  • Collaborate remotely with other clinicians to deliver coordinated, high-quality care.
  • Stay updated on telehealth standards and evolving best practices.

Who You Are

  • MD or DO with board certification in Internal Medicine, Family Medicine, Emergency Medicine, or OB/GYN.
  • ABOM certification is a plus.
  • Licensed in multiple U.S. states (ideally including CA, TX, or IL).
  • Comfortable using digital platforms and practicing in a fully remote environment.
  • Excellent communicator who connects easily with patients virtually.

Nice to Have

  • Telemedicine experience or strong interest in virtual care.
  • Passion for obesity and chronic disease management.
  • Comfort providing preventive and lifestyle guidance.

What You’ll Get

  • Annual salary starting at $210,000, plus potential performance bonuses.
  • Flexible, fully remote schedule that fits your lifestyle.
  • Support for state licensing through the IMLC Compact.
  • 25 days of PTO and room for career growth in a rapidly expanding digital health company.
  • A diverse, mission-driven community of clinicians committed to equitable healthcare access.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
